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Country Club of West Georgia, the (Villa Rica, GA)
Nestled in the rolling hills of West Georgia, the Country Club of West Georgia is situated in Villa Rica, a city with a growing suburban appeal. The club is located off I-20, providing relatively easy access for those coming from Atlanta or points west. The primary access road is Monticello Drive, a well-maintained route leading directly to the club's entrance. For those flying in,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L) is the closest major hub, though smaller regional airports may also serve the area. Driving times from Atlanta can vary significantly based on traffic, particularly during peak commute hours on I-20, with typical travel taking 45 minutes to over an hour. Public transportation options are limited in this more spread-out suburban area, making a personal vehicle or rideshare service the most practical modes of transport. Smart arrival tactics often involve planning to arrive 15-20 minutes before your scheduled tee time or event start to account for parking and check-in procedures, especially if arriving during a known busy period for the club or surrounding golf courses.

Weather & Seasons at Country Club of West Georgia, the
- Winter: Winter in West Georgia typically brings cool to mild temperatures, with average highs in the 50s Fahrenheit and occasional dips into the 30s. Mornings can be crisp and require layers, making jackets or sweaters essential for early tee times. While snow is rare, frost can sometimes delay the start of play. Visitors should pack comfortable, layered clothing suitable for changing temperatures throughout the day.
- Spring & early summer: Spring offers delightful weather with temperatures gradually warming into the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it. This season is perfect for golf, with blooming flora adding beauty to the course. Early summer remains pleasant before the peak heat arrives, with average highs in the comfortable mid-80s. Light, breathable fabrics are recommended, and it's wise to carry a light jacket for cooler evenings.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er (July and August) brings significant heat and humidity to the region, with daytime temperatures frequently reaching the high 80s and 90s Fahrenheit. Hydration is paramount, and visitors should wear light, moisture-wicking clothing. Afternoon thunderstorms are common, so checking weather forecasts and planning rounds accordingly is advisable. Sunscreen and hats are essential.
- Fall season: Fall, from September through November, transitions back to comfortable temperatures, often in the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it, with crisp air. The foliage can provide beautiful scenery on the golf course. This is another prime season for outdoor activities, with cooler mornings gradually warming into pleasant afternoons. Layers are again recommended as the season progresses towards cooler late autumn weather.
- Rain & snow: Rain is common throughout the year in Georgia, particularly during spring and summer thunderstorm seasons. Visitors should pack a rain jacket or umbrella, especially for outdoor activities. Snowfall is infrequent and usually does not accumulate significantly, but can cause minor disruptions if it occurs during winter months. Be prepared for potential weather delays, especially for outdoor events.
